The music was good in the movie, and I just finished listening to the soundtrack. I don't care for modern songs, and one included here wasn't an exception (I Ain't Worried sure Ain't for me), but the Lady Gaga song, God help me, wasn't too bad. It sounded as though it could have been on the original soundtrack which I actually enjoyed. Kenny Loggins' Danger Zone was/is awesome and is present too which is great. The score seemed subdued, however. Standout tracks were Darkstar and The Man, The Legend/Touchdown, but the new or updated Anthem was merely ok. I'm sure there's a lot not released, and I understand the Japanese version includes another action track which I'd love to hear so hopefully there's more to come.

I'll go back to see the movie again, and I'm sure my son will want to go too (he's only a year older than I was when the original came out- by the way, he liked Iron Eagle better than original Top Gun too), but the new soundtrack won't get the play the original has gotten over the year despite the lack of score tracks.
